About 10 Gisborne Road
10 Gisborne Road is a four-bedroom semi-detached house in Sheffield (S11 7HA). It has a recorded floor area of 171 m² (around 1841 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1930-1949 and council tax band D. The latest certificate (August 2016) shows a D (score 63), on the cusp of jumping into the C band. The recommended improvements would push it to C (score 77). Other recorded features include a self-contained annexe and a basement. Period features are noted in the property record. Records show the property has been extended at some point in its history.
At 171 m² it's 17.3% larger than the typical home in the postcode (146 m² median across 12 EPCs). On the market in July 2017 and unlisted since — roughly 9 years. Today's modelled estimate of £603,000 is 43.6% above the 2017 sale price.
